Written question asked by Steve Darling (Liberal Democrat) on Thursday, 9 July 2026, in the House of Commons. It was due for an answer on Monday, 13 July 2026. It was answered by Paul Waugh (Labour) on Tuesday, 4 August 2026 on behalf of the Department for Education.


Free School Meals

Question

To ask the Secretary of State for Education, what estimate they have made of the number of children eligible for free school meals who are not registered to receive them.

Answer

The department only collects data on pupils who are both eligible for and claiming free school meals. Children not claiming free school meals could be eligible or ineligible to claim them. As a result, no recent estimate has been made of the number of children eligible for but not registered to receive free school meals.
